Ipswich suburbs: stumps to slabs
Ipswich's inner suburbs — Woodend, Coalfalls, Sadliers Crossing, Eastern Heights and Newtown — hold an unusually dense run of timber Queenslanders from the city's boom years in the 1860s through to the early 1900s. Most sit on stumps with open subfloor access, which is the single biggest advantage a cabler gets in this trade: cable runs underneath the house, comes up inside a wall cavity, and the only visible work is the wall plate itself.
The growth corridor tells the opposite story. The Ripley Valley Priority Development Area alone is planned for close to 48,750 dwellings and around 131,000 people over a twenty to thirty year build-out, with roughly 7,200 homes and two trading town centres already in the ground as of 2026. Add Yamanto, Deebing Heights, Augustine Heights, Redbank Plains and South Ripley and that is a lot of slab-on-ground brick veneer with no subfloor at all — every run has to come from the roof cavity, and a single-storey slab home with a hip roof usually cables without fuss.
Flooding is the other thing that shapes a data cabling Ipswich job. The Bremer River catchment has produced major floods in 1974, 2011 and 2022 — the January 2011 event peaked at 19.40 metres on the Ipswich gauge, February 2022 at 16.72 metres — and low-lying pockets near the Bremer and its feeder creeks have been re-stumped or raised as a result. On a subfloor job in one of those areas, the clearance and the flood line worth building above are both worth asking about before quoting, not after.

NBN and private fibre networks across Ipswich
Established Ipswich suburbs mostly came online through the original national rollout on fibre-to-the-node, the same as most of established Brisbane, with a federal upgrade program now offering eligible fibre-to-the-node premises a free move to full fibre. That part of the picture is not unique to Ipswich — it is standard rollout history repeating across most of South East Queensland's older suburbs.
The growth corridor is where it gets genuinely local. A 2016 policy change means NBN Co is no longer required to run fibre to every new estate, and developers are free to contract a private network operator instead — the same commercial players who run private fibre networks in new estates right across the country. That means two stages of the same Ipswich estate can land on different networks, with different equipment at the boundary point.
Before assuming what network termination device is sitting in the garage of a new Ripley or Yamanto build, it is worth checking rather than guessing. Why registration matters here too
The rule that governs data cabling Ipswich work is federal, not local. Fixed cabling that connects to a telecommunications network must be installed by a registered cabling provider, or by someone directly supervised at all times by one, under section 21 of the Telecommunications (Cabling Provider) Rules 2025. It applies the same way whether the job is two blocks from Ipswich City Council or in the Brisbane CBD, and it is separate from any electrical licence — Queensland's Electrical Safety Act 2002 says at section 55(3) that an electrical licence is not required for telecommunications cabling work.
Work here is carried out under the same ACMA cabler registration as every other job this business does — registration no. 42489, open class, the broadest of the three registration classes. Where a job involves a specialised category such as structured or optical fibre cabling, section 22 requires the cabler to hold the completed units for it, notified to the registrar. The same registered data cabler who works Brisbane covers Ipswich, and every job gets the written compliance statement required under section 25, supplied whether or not the invoice is paid yet.

Cat6 or Cat6A for a data cabling Ipswich install
The split in Ipswich's housing stock makes this an easier call than usual for most data cabling Ipswich jobs. A weatherboard or brick home in Woodend, Coalfalls or Raceview with a run under 30 metres does the job on Cat6 — gigabit to the full 100 metres, and the labour is identical to Cat6A either way. A new build in Ripley Valley or Redbank Plains going in with PoE cameras, an access point ceiling drop and possible future 10 gigabit switching is better served starting with Cat6A, because re-pulling cable through a finished slab home is a much bigger job than doing it once, properly.
| Cat6 | Cat6A | |
|---|---|---|
| 1 Gbps | 100 m | 100 m |
| 10 Gbps | ~55 m | 100 m |
| Screening | Usually unscreened | Screened against alien crosstalk |
| Outside diameter | ~6.0 mm | ~7.5 mm |
| Suits | Older Ipswich homes, short runs | New estates, PoE, Swanbank & Ebenezer sites |
What data cabling Ipswich quotes actually cost
Access is what moves a data cabling Ipswich quote, more than the cable itself. A Queenslander with clear subfloor access is one of the quicker jobs going, because the cable never has to touch the ceiling at all. A two-storey rendered home with no subfloor and a sealed roof space, or a Ripley slab build where the ceiling has already gone up around the trusses, takes longer for the exact same outlet count.
Structured cabling is generally priced per outlet — cable, both terminations, wall plate, patch panel port, testing and labelling — with the per-point rate dropping as the count rises. Fault finding and small additions are priced hourly instead; published Brisbane-region rates for comparable work sit around $185 per hour for standard hours, with a premium for after-hours or emergency callouts. Home network cabling in Ipswich houses
A lot of residential data cabling Ipswich enquiries start as Wi-Fi complaints, and they usually trace back to the same cause as everywhere else — one router trying to cover a floor plan it was never going to reach on its own. A single cabled ceiling point roughly central to the house, feeding a proper access point, fixes more coverage problems than any router upgrade, and it is the most common reason a home network cabling enquiry starts in the first place.
In an older Ipswich Queenslander, that ceiling point is usually a short subfloor-to-wall-cavity run with no wall damage at all. In a Ripley Valley or Deebing Heights build it comes from the roof space instead, which still leaves the wall plate as the only visible change once the job is done. Do the 2011 and 2022 Bremer River floods affect subfloor cabling in older Ipswich suburbs?
In low-lying pockets near the Bremer and its creeks, yes. Homes that were re-stumped or raised after those floods often have different subfloor clearance to what the original build had, and any cable or junction run down there needs to sit above the flood line that prompted the rebuild, not just above the old one.

What cabling do Swanbank and Ebenezer industrial sites in Ipswich actually need?
Large floor plates and long runs mean the 100 metre copper channel limit gets hit fast, so a satellite comms cabinet fed by fibre is usually the answer rather than one enormous copper run. Add PoE cameras and access points around the site and Cat6A becomes the sensible default, not an upgrade.

Who do I call for a data cabling fault in an Ipswich office fitout?
A registered cabler, not the IT helpdesk. Ports negotiating at 100 megabit instead of gigabit, intermittent drops after a fitout, or a run cut during other trades' work are physical layer faults, and tracing them means testing the actual link against the standard rather than guessing at software fixes.
